Virna Jandiroba used strong wrestling and grappling to beat Tabatha Ricci by unanimous decision at UFC Fight Night 272.
Fight summary
Jandiroba controlled most of the fight with takedowns, top pressure, and steady control on the mat. Ricci showed moments of striking and scrambling, but could not keep Jandiroba from returning to top position. The judges scored the bout for Jandiroba by unanimous decision, 30-27 and 29-28 twice.
Round-by-round recap
Round One: Ricci started fast with a quick flurry of punches. Jandiroba stalked and secured a takedown, then worked for position on the ground. Ricci scrambled and briefly got back to her feet, but Jandiroba stayed close and soon took her down again. The round ended with Jandiroba holding control while Ricci protected herself on the canvas.
Round Two: Ricci landed a solid kick early, but Jandiroba got another takedown near the center of the Octagon. From top, Jandiroba looked to pass guard while Ricci threw elbows from her back and tried a leg lock. Jandiroba kept top position and landed an elbow that briefly dropped Ricci. A late takedown by Jandiroba kept her in control into the final moments of the round.
Round Three: Ricci stuffed an early single-leg and briefly got the fight to the ground for the first time. Jandiroba fought back up and later landed another takedown. She took Ricci’s back with a hook and threatened a rear-naked choke, but Ricci defended and turned into top position as the horn sounded. The round featured several exchanges, a head kick attempt from Ricci, and Jandiroba finishing with strong grappling control.
Key moments and takeaways
Jandiroba won by dictating where the fight took place. Her takedowns and time on top gave her the edge on the judges’ scorecards. Ricci had bright moments with strikes, knees, and a successful scramble in the third, but she was unable to string enough offense to change the outcome.
The official result was a unanimous decision for Jandiroba with scores of 30-27, 29-28, and 29-28.
